RCBC Nursing Associate’s Program

Of the 119 nursing students who graduated with a associate's degree in 2020-2021 from RCBC, about 10% were men and 90% were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 61%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Rowan College at Burlington County with a associate's in nursing.

undefined
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 5
Black or African American 12
Hispanic or Latino 11
White 72
Non-Resident Aliens 4
Other Races 15
